  2. Begin by filling out the Demographic Information section. Enter your National Provider Identifier (NPI) and Social Security Number (SSN) if applicable. If you do not have an SSN, refer to the Declaration of No Social Security Number Form.
  3. Provide your Legal Name, Birth Date, and Address. Ensure that all information is accurate as it will be used for correspondence regarding your license.
  4. List any Other License, Certification, or Registration you have held since your last credentialing in Washington State. Include details such as the state, profession, and year issued.
  5. Detail your Professional Experience since your Washington State credential expired. Include start and end dates for each position.
  6. Complete the Disciplinary Action Attestation and Continuing Education Attestation sections by certifying that you meet all requirements.
  7. Finally, sign and date the Applicant’s Attestation to confirm that all information provided is true and complete before submitting your application.

How to Renew Your Washington Nurse License Online. All RNs, LPNs, NTECs, and ARNPs can now be renewed (on time or late) or reactivated online through the HELMS Portal. You can renew your license online 85-90 days before your license expires.
There is no grace period for operating a vehicle or vessel with an expired registration. However, when the registration expiration falls on a Saturday, Sunday, or legal holiday, the registration extends through the end of the next business day.

The fine for expired tabs is $145 for the first two months after expiration. Any later and the fine increases to $237, according to Trooper Chris Thorson with the Washington State Patrol. To avoid these fines, you can sign up for email reminders when its time to update your tabs.

Vehicle registrations must be renewed annually to remain current and allow the owner to drive the vehicle on the public roadways in Washington state (including Pacific Ocean beaches). There is no grace period for operating a vehicle or vessel with an expired registration.
